Sans Superellipse Uhvo 7 is a very bold, very wide, monoline, upright, tall x-height font.

This sans has a modular, rounded-rectangle construction with consistently softened corners and a uniform stroke weight. Forms are generally squarish and wide, with compact apertures and counters that read as inset rectangles (notably in characters like O, D, e, and 0). Joins and terminals are clean and blunt, creating a crisp, engineered rhythm; diagonals (A, V, W, X, Y, Z) are straight and sturdy, while curves resolve into superellipse-like bowls. Spacing feels assertive and stable, with a high visual density that keeps word shapes blocky and cohesive.

Best suited for display settings where its distinctive squared, rounded geometry can be appreciated—headlines, posters, packaging callouts, and logotypes. It also fits interface-style applications such as gaming overlays, sci-fi screens, and tech-oriented branding where compact, engineered letterforms help create a bold, contemporary voice.

The overall tone is futuristic and technical, evoking digital interfaces, sci-fi titling, and industrial labeling. Its blocky silhouettes and squared curves give it a confident, machine-made feel that suggests precision and strength more than warmth or delicacy.

The design appears intended to translate rounded-rectangle geometry into a highly legible, contemporary display sans with a consistent, system-like rhythm. It prioritizes strong silhouettes, crisp terminals, and a compact internal structure to project a modern, tech-forward personality.

At text sizes the tight openings and inset counters can reduce internal clarity, while at larger sizes the distinctive squared-round geometry becomes a strong stylistic asset. Numerals match the alphabet’s boxy, rounded construction and look suited to dashboards and scoring/ID contexts.
